How did the Japanese plan to catch the European colonial powers and the United States by surprise?
Gemiola [76]

Answer:

They planned massive attacks on British and Dutch colonies in Southeast Asia and on American outposts in the Pacific—at the same time. He would then seize islands that were not well defended but were closer to Japan.
